No, Beorn referred to Bilbo as a "bunny" ("Little bunny is getting nice and fat again on bread and honey," he chuckled. "Come and have some more!") but both Bert the Troll and the Eagle king referred to Bilbo as a rabbit, and Thorin shook him "like a rabbit" when he discovered that Bilbo had stolen the Arkenstone.
